Sign up for LibraryThing to find out whether you'll like this book. No current Talk conversations about this book. This seemed like at early author work with not good editing. Too much repetition of thoughts and events. Enjoyed the beginning half with learning about each person and their family lives. Interesting how the mothers bonded as well and created good friendships also. After the deaths of the model, then the football player, the story went downhill. I understood Izzy's depression setting in but it dragged down the story. Never figured out why Andy the doctor did not connect more to Izzy before his tragedy. ( ) Friends forever by Danielle Steel Izzy, Gabby, Billy, Shawn and Andy are friends throughout the years (k through 12) at the prestigiuos private school. Better chance to get in if you had another sibling there already. Services also offered physiological help and help with colleges. Story follows the parents and their lives. Very confusing to me because there are so many of them. What I do like about this book is the pact they make in 2nd grade and how many different situations they go through. Like hearing of the older children, infants and parents lives. Tragedies occur when they are older as they thought they were invincilbe. Forging inseparable bonds in childhood that reinforce them throughout their teen years, two girls and three boys go their separate ways as adults and encounter respective tragedies and transformations. No library descriptions found. |
